First Facility Operational: Essential Grid-Connected Storage Batteries for Renewable Energy Proliferation In recent years, with the advancement of DX and the shift from fossil fuels to electricity, electricity demand continues to increase. The government has set a goal to increase the ratio of renewable energy to over 40% by 2040. To ensure a stable supply of renewable energy, which is susceptible to natural cycles and has fluctuating power generation, the widespread adoption of grid-connected storage batteries is indispensable for responding to output fluctuations and balancing electricity supply and demand. ADW has been engaged in the development of grid-connected storage batteries since 2025. The 'ADW Mie Matsusaka City Storage Battery Plant', its first facility completed in January of this year, has now completed its trial operation and main connection (※) and has commenced operations. Initially, operations will begin in the JPEX wholesale market, with plans to enter the supply and demand adjustment market after a certain monitoring period.

※Main connection: The physical and technical connection of an independent 'grid-connected storage battery (storage plant)' to the transmission and distribution network (grid) managed by the power company, enabling the exchange of electricity.

AD Works Group Co., Ltd. The ADWG Group, consisting of AD Works Group Co., Ltd. and its subsidiaries (operating companies), is an investment solutions company centered on real estate, with its headquarters in Tokyo and bases in Osaka, Fukuoka, and Los Angeles.

Its current company name originates from "Aoki Dyeing Works," tracing its roots back to the "Aoki Dyeing Factory" founded in 1886. This history of nearly 140 years is widely known among employees.
